How does the poet (Nissim Ezekiel) describe the father's actions towards the mother's scorpion sting?

AHe tries various remedies

BHe remains passive and does nothing

CHe seeks the help of doctors immediately

DHe blames the mother for being careless

Answer:

A. He tries various remedies

Read Explanation:

  • The father is a rationalist.

  • He tries various remedies including curses, blessings, powders, and even burning the affected toe with paraffin.

  • Despite his efforts, the sting takes twenty hours to lose its effect.
